Mode 0 Programming Example

Main() {

#define BASE_ADDRESS

0x210

/* Board located at address 210 */

#define PORTAoffset

0x00

/* Offset for port A */

#define PORTBoffset

0x01

/* Offset for port B */

#define PORTCoffset

0x02

/* Offset for port C */

#define CNFGoffset

0x03

/* Offset for CNFG */

register unsigned int porta, portb, portc, cnfg;
char valread;

/* Variable to store data read from a

port */

/* Calculate register addresses. */
porta = BASE_ADDRESS + PORTAoffset;
portb = BASE_ADDRESS + PORTBoffset;
portc = BASE_ADDRESS + PORTCoffset;
cnfg = BASE_ADDRESS + CNFGoffset;
